mysql 如何自定义排序_在MySQL中实现自定义排序顺序
要在MySQL中实现自定义排序顺序,您需要使用ORDER BY FIELD()。让我们首先创建一个表-create table DemoTable
-> (
-> Designation varchar(100)
-> );
使用插入命令在表中插入一些记录-insert into DemoTable values('Software Engineer');
insert into DemoTable values('Associate Software Engineer');
insert into DemoTable values('Software Development Engineer');
insert into DemoTable values('Product Manager');
使用select语句显示表中的所有记录-select *from DemoTable;
这将产生以下输出-+-------------------------------+
| Designation |
+-------------------------------+
| Software Engineer |
| Associate Software Engineer |
| Software Development Engineer |
| Product Manager |
+-------------------------------+
4 rows in set (0.00 sec)
以下是在MySQL中实现自定义排序顺序的查询-select *from DemoTable
-> order by
field(Designation,'Associate Software Engineer','Software Engineer','Software Development Engineer','Product Manager');
这将产生以下输出-+-------------------------------+
| Designation |
+-------------------------------+
| Associate Software Engineer |
| Software Engineer |
| Software Development Engineer |
| Product Manager |
+-------------------------------+
4 rows in set (0.02 sec)
mysql 如何自定义排序_在MySQL中实现自定义排序顺序相关推荐
- mybatis多字段排序_解决mybatis中order by排序无效问题
1.#将传入的数据都当成一个字符串,会对自动传入的数据加一个双引号.如:order by #{user_id},如果传入的值是111,那么解析成sql时的值为order by "111&qu ...
- tableau 自定义省份_在Tableau中使用自定义图像映射
tableau 自定义省份 We have been reading about all the ways to make our vizzes in Tableau with more creati ...
- java list 元素排序_对arraylist中元素进行排序实例代码
rrayList中的元素进行排序,主要考查的是对util包中的Comparator接口和Collections类的使用. 实现Comparator接口必须实现compare方法,自己可以去看API帮助 ...
- java 自定义事件_在Java中创建自定义事件
你可能想调查一下观测器模式. 下面是一些让自己开始工作的示例代码:import java.util.*;// An interface to be implemented by everyone in ...
- mysql自定义两个条件排序_使用MySQL中的两个不同列进行自定义排序?
为此,将ORDER BY子句与CASE语句一起使用.让我们首先创建一个表-mysql> create table DemoTable1610 -> ( -> Marks int, - ...
- mysql按中文拼音字母排序_解析MySQL按常规排序、自定义排序和按中文拼音字母排序的方法...
MySQL常规排序.自定义排序和按中文拼音字母排序,在实际的SQL编写时,我们有时候需要对条件集合进行排序.下面给出3种比较常用的排序方式,一起看看吧 MySQL常规排序.自定义排序和按中文拼音字母排 ...
- mysql 如何对表排序_学习MySQL:对表中的数据进行排序和过滤
mysql 如何对表排序 In this article, we will learn how we can sort and filter data using the WHERE clause a ...
- mysql zerofill设置方法_在MySQL中使用ZEROFILL设置自定义自动增量
让我们首先创建一个表.这里.我们使用ZEROFILL和AUTO_INCREMENT设置了UserId列mysql> create table DemoTable1831 ( UserId int ...
- mysql临时文件和临时表_理解mysql的临时表和文件排序
我们经常看到Mysql的explain语句执行结果Extra字段有using temporary或者using filesort,本文主要是为了理解这两个短语的含义,从而有助于我们进行SQL语句优化. ...
最新文章
- ansible 介绍
- 【机器学习入门到精通系列】无监督学习之K-means
- 一年以来我最好的创意
- MySQL的内连和外连
- Spring MVC开发–快速教程
- 【渝粤教育】国家开放大学2018年秋季 0699-21T阅读与写作 参考试题
- Flutter搜索框SearchBar
- hbase_学习_01_HBase环境搭建(单机)
- 布林通道参数用20还是26_这样设置均线参数
- linux kernel峰会视频,2010 年 Linux 内核峰会,11月美国
- 关于企业费控管理的这些陷阱,你知道吗?
- NSURLSession访问HTTPS网站
- 使用JRebel进行Java Web项目的热部署
- paip.使用JAVASCRIPT开发桌面与WEB程序
- php给数据库添加记录,数据表操作之添加数据表记录
- python双色球代码_python实现双色球随机选号
- 转换函数(Transfer Function)设计
- 蚂蚁金服实习三面,offer已拿。我总结了所有面试题,其实也不过如此!!
- 环比同比YOY\QoQ及QQ\PP图Q-Q\P-P…
- 【Python框架】Scrapy简单入门及实例讲解